41 EASTCOURT ROAD is a very small extended semi-detached house of 74m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966, which could now be worth an estimated £454,275. It was last sold for £395,000 in March 2021, which was around 42% above the average March 2021 semi-detached price in the Wiltshire local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was November 2013,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was B.

What might 41 EASTCOURT ROAD be worth now?

41 EASTCOURT ROAD might now be worth an estimated £454,275.

This is based on house price inflation of 15%, between March 2021 and July 2025, for semi-detached houses, in the Wiltshire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 15%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 41 EASTCOURT ROAD of £395,000 on 8th March 2021. For the value to have increased from £395,000 to £454,275 over the three years and eight months to July 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 41 EASTCOURT 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Wiltshire local authority area.
  • The March 2021 sale price of £395,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 41 EASTCOURT ROAD has not materially changed since March 2021.
